Self-Clinching Nuts

We stock several different types of self-clinching nuts.

  • Nut: Considered a standard self-clinching nut, this type of nut does not encapsulate your threads. Protrudes on one side of the sheet metal.
  • Miniature nut: This type of nut is used to place fasteners closer to the edge of a part. Protrudes on one side of the sheet metal.
  • Floating nut: A floating nut allows looser tolerance on hole placement because if they are not perfectly aligned, the thread can float over to receive the fastener. Protrudes on one side of the sheet metal.
  • Blind nut: A blind nut encapsulates your threads, typically to prevent any foreign material from entering inside. Protrudes on one side of the sheet metal.
  • Flush nut: This nut is installed flush with your sheet metal and does not protrude on either side of your case. A great replacement for a threaded hole.
  • Nylon insert nut: This type of nut contains a nylon inserted locking thread that increases friction with the screw to enable tighter locking. Protrudes on one side of the sheet metal.
